A Tale of Two Textures

Scones:

  • Dense and crumbly
  • Lightly sweet or savory
  • Typically cut into triangular wedges

Crumpets:

  • Soft and spongy
  • Slightly chewy
  • Perforated with small, irregular holes

The Art of Preparation

Scones:

  • Made with flour, butter, sugar, and baking powder
  • Cut out and baked on a baking sheet

Crumpets:

  • A batter-based creation
  • Cooked on a griddle or crumpet ring, resulting in the distinctive holes

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the difference between a scone and a crumpet?
Scones are dense and crumbly, while crumpets are soft and spongy. Scones are typically cut into triangular wedges, while crumpets are round and perforated with small holes.

2. Which is healthier, a scone or a crumpet?
Crumpets are generally lower in calories and fat and contain more protein than scones.

3. What are the most popular toppings for scones and crumpets?
Scones are often served with clotted cream and strawberry jam, while crumpets are traditionally topped with butter and strawberry preserves.

4. Can scones and crumpets be made gluten-free?
Yes, it is possible to make gluten-free versions of both scones and crumpets using alternative flours such as almond flour or buckwheat flour.

5. Are scones and crumpets only eaten for breakfast?
While scones and crumpets are commonly enjoyed for breakfast, they can also be enjoyed as snacks or afternoon treats.
